Why RTP and Volatility Matter
Return to Player (RTP) and volatility are the two metrics that most influence your long-term results. RTP indicates the percentage of wagered money a slot returns over time, while volatility describes how often and how big the wins tend to be. High RTP and medium volatility is a common combination for players seeking steady returns with occasional larger payouts.

Choosing Between Megaways, Classic and Video Pokies
Megaways titles offer dynamic reel layouts and thousands of win lines, ideal for players who enjoy volatility and fast action. Classic three-reel pokies are simpler and appeal to nostalgia players. Video pokies balance features and graphics with accessible gameplay; these are often best for most players seeking variety and features like cascading reels or multipliers.

Practical Bankroll Tips
- Set a session budget and stick to it.
- Bet a small percentage of your bankroll per spin (e.g., 1-2%).
- Take breaks to avoid fatigue-driven decisions.
- Use bonuses wisely—read wagering requirements thoroughly.
Quick Comparison Table: Popular Pokie Types
| Type | Typical RTP |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Classic Pokies | 92%–96% | Simple gameplay, low volatility |
| Video Pokies | 94%–97% | Feature-rich play, balanced wins |
| Megaways | 95%–96.5% | High volatility, big hit potential |
| Progressive Jackpots | Varies widely | Chance at massive prizes |
